Golda Meir celebrated her 122nd birthday

Mazal Tov! Yesterday former PM Golda Meir, the “Iron Lady”, celebrated her 122nd birthday Golda Meir was the world’s third and Israel’s first and only woman to hold the office of Prime Minister! The World Zionist Organisation in UK holds an annual Golden Golda Award recognising women who have made a contribution to Zionism, the promotion of Aliyah and Israel.
